Elliott Yamin Live

I am a huge fan of the TV show American Idol. I enjoy watching the show from the very crazy audition process up to the grand finals night. I never fail to watch a single episode. Last season 5 my favorite contestant was Elliott Yamin... I was floored when I heard his rendition of Moody's Mood for Love at AI and immediately became a big fan. I also liked his very humble demeanor... and later I learned more facts about him such as he is nearly deaf in his right ear, he has type 1 diabetes, he had no formal voice training, he is very close to his mom.... that made me more interested in him as a person and a performer. I was extremely disappointed when he was eliminated at AI and did not make it to the finals... his voice in my opinion is far superior than the other two finalist. I just have to console myself and hoped that he will have a recording deal. I even promised myself that I will definitely buy his CD.


When I learned that Ayala malls is going to bring him here in the Philippines I really hoped that I will be able to see him perform in person. I later learned from my friend Alma that tickets are limited and we need a ton of luck to have one. I was already feeling bad about the fact that we missed to secure tickets for the Avenue Q musical a few days ago and now it seems that I'll be missing Elliott's gig as well. My original plan was to watch his show in Trinoma but I missed it. Around past 12 noon and am just lounging at home after having lunch I received a txt message from Alma "You still wanna see Elliott? Meet me at exactly 550pm at mcdo Glorietta. I have an extra ticket . We have to be there by 6pm . Seats will be given to others if we are late." I jumped out of our couch and immediately headed to the bathroom to take a shower. I came around 545pm but Alma was nowhere in sight.....there were already alot of people lining up to be seated. I was so worried that we'll lose our seat....around 630pm Alma finally came.

We were seated at the 5th row right of the middle and it gave us a good view of the stage. The Glorietta crowd was a really great audience... they cheered, screamed, stomped their feet, and even sang along with Elliott. Elliott sounds much much better live in person. I've got goosebumps all over with how awesome he sings his songs. He was also profusely sweating despite the pretty cool AC at Gloriettea... must be the heat from the spotlight. However this did not matter a single bit with the way he performed on stage.... he sings like Yamin it :-) sorry.... I can't help myself. Elliott performed for more than 45 minutes.....



Elliot sang around seven songs and one of my favorite was his rendition of "I'm the Man'. I recorded and even posted it in my youtube account....
